Charlie Kirk, a prominent conservative activist and co-founder of Turning Point USA, was fatally shot while speaking at a rally at Utah Valley University on September 10, 2025. The shooting has sparked widespread condemnation and raised concerns about political violence and gun safety. The incident has led to increased scrutiny of gun laws and regulations, potentially driving up demand for firearms.
According to data from financial markets, shares of Smith & Wesson Brands, Sturm, Ruger & Company, and American Outdoor Brands rose by 5% to 7% following the news of Kirk's shooting. This trend is indicative of the broader market sentiment, where investors view the incident as a catalyst for potential changes in gun regulations and increased consumer interest in firearms.
The shooting has also sparked bipartisan condemnation, with politicians from both sides of the aisle expressing their condolences and calling for action against political violence. The incident has highlighted the divisive nature of gun control debates and the potential impact of such events on the firearms industry.
While the immediate impact of the shooting on gun stocks is evident, the long-term effects remain uncertain. The incident could potentially lead to changes in gun laws, which could influence the demand for firearms. Additionally, the increased awareness of gun safety and political violence may lead to more stringent regulations, which could impact the industry negatively.
In conclusion, the shooting of Charlie Kirk has had an immediate impact on gun stocks, with shares of major firearms manufacturers experiencing a significant increase in value. The incident has sparked concerns about gun safety and political violence, potentially driving up demand for firearms in the short term. However, the long-term effects on the industry remain uncertain, and the potential for changes in gun laws could have a more profound impact on the market.
